Last year, we heard from reader Veronica Njoku-Carter the kind of tale we’ve been hearing for decades. A college counselor in California, she was browsing our e-mail newsletter in bed the morning after Thanksgiving when she spotted a headline that made her curious. 6park.com As she read our comfortingly scientific article, she got worried. Her husband, Derrick Carter, hadn’t been feeling great for a while; now the little discomforts he’d noted jumped off her screen. All were symptoms of congestive heart failure. 6park.comShe got him to phone his doctor immediately. The call nurse directed him straight to the ER. “I thank God that I read your article when I did,” Njoku-Carter wrote. “It saved his life.” At the hospital, an angiogram revealed three blocked arteries. “We had no idea his symptoms were signs of something so severe,” Njoku-Carter said. Five days and a few stents later, he was back at home, alive and well...
